2024年1月14日发(作者:)
移动应用开发中的虚拟键盘处理方法
移动应用开发已经成为当今信息技术领域的热门话题。如今,人们几乎每天都在使用手机、平板电脑等移动设备,因此许多开发者都在致力于创建出更加人性化、便于操作的应用程序。而在移动应用开发中,虚拟键盘的处理方法是一个不容忽视的重要环节。
虚拟键盘是一种由软件产生的屏幕键盘,通过用户在屏幕上的触摸输入文字和命令。虽然虚拟键盘在提供便利的同时,也带来了一些挑战,比如对用户输入的实时处理、键盘的布局和样式等。因此,为了提升用户的操作体验,开发者需要采取一些方法来处理虚拟键盘。
首先,虚拟键盘的实时处理是移动应用开发中的一项重要任务。在用户使用虚拟键盘输入文字时,应用程序需要实时地响应用户的输入,并将其准确地转化为文字或命令。为了达到这一目的,开发者可以使用一些技术手段,比如使用事件监听器来监控键盘输入的变化,并及时作出响应。
其次,虚拟键盘的布局和样式也是需要考虑的重要因素。不同的应用程序可能需要不同的键盘布局和样式,以适应不同场景下的需求。例如,对于输入密码的场景,可能需要使用特殊的数字键盘;而在输入邮件地址时,可能需要使用带有“@”符号的键盘。因此,开发者需要根据具体的应用场景,对虚拟键盘的布局和样式进行定制。
此外,虚拟键盘的自动调整功能也是提升用户体验的一项重要方法。在一些应用场景中,当用户在虚拟键盘上输入文字时,可能会遮挡住输入框或其他重要内容。为了解决这个问题,开发者可以使用自动调整功能,使输入框根据键盘的高度自动上移,确保用户输入的文字能够清晰可见。这样不仅能够方便用户的操作,还能提升应用程序的整体质量。
在实际开发中,我们还可以加入一些额外的功能来提升虚拟键盘的处理效果。例如,可以增加输入预测功能,根据用户的输入习惯和上下文,提供输入建议和纠错功能,减少用户的输入错误。另外,为了方便用户的操作,还可以添加一些快捷键或手势操作,用于执行特定的命令或功能。这些额外的功能能够让用户更加高效地使用虚拟键盘,提升应用程序的易用性和便利性。
当然,虚拟键盘的处理方法还有很多,这只是其中的一部分。在实际开发中,开发者需要根据具体的需求和应用场景,选择合适的方法和技术。同时,不断地对用户的反馈进行分析和调整,以优化虚拟键盘的使用体验。
总之,在移动应用开发中,虚拟键盘处理方法至关重要。通过实时处理、布局和样式调整、自动调整功能以及额外的功能增加,可以提升用户对虚拟键盘的操作体验,从而提升整个应用程序的质量和用户满意度。只有不断地关注和改进虚拟键盘的处理方法,才能够在激烈的市场竞争中脱颖而出,满足用户的需求。


发布评论